Ruby indentation control in VS C
2019-05-14 本文已影响0人
黑谷先生
-
在Ruby script以及相应的config.yml中,建议的缩进都是两个空格。
每次都敲两个空格太不专业麻烦,但是按Tab键默认的又是4个空格。所以可以在VS Code中设置Tab的默认size为2,就可以使用Tab键来控制缩进了。
File --> Preferences --> Settings --> Search "Tab Size"
Tab Size Settings
-
借助Rubocop可以看到script中缩进不符合规范的地方。
Rubocop checking
-
需要修改整个code block的缩进时,可以借助VS Code的列选择功能 - 使用快捷键Ctrl+Alt+鼠标单击选择code block。
Column Select
-
这时就可以使用Backspace键和Tab键来控制整个code block的缩进了。
Code Block Indentation